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’s) For Case Reviewer
What is the role of a Case Reviewer?
A Case Reviewer is responsible for reviewing and evaluating insurance claims, identifying key issues, and developing recommendations for resolution. They analyze witness statements, medical records, and other evidentiary documents to determine the validity of claims, and interview clients, adjusters, and medical professionals to gather information and assess the credibility of testimony.
What skills are required to be a successful Case Reviewer?
To be a successful Case Reviewer, you need strong analytical and problem-solving skills, as well as the ability to work independently and as part of a team. You should also have excellent communication and interviewing skills, and be proficient in case management software and databases.
What is the career path for a Case Reviewer?
Many Case Reviewers start their careers as claims adjusters or insurance underwriters. With experience, they can move into more senior roles, such as claims manager or litigation manager. Some Case Reviewers also go on to become independent consultants.
How can I prepare for a career as a Case Reviewer?
To prepare for a career as a Case Reviewer, you can earn a degree in criminal justice, risk management, or a related field. You can also gain experience working as a claims adjuster or insurance underwriter. Additionally, you can take courses in case management, insurance law, and fraud investigation.
